Clinical efficacy of combined nasolabial fat liposuction and thread lift for facial rejuvenation: A 3D imaging and patient satisfaction study
Objectives: Nasolabial folds are a common concern across all ages and ethnicities. Causes vary, but in Asian women in their 20s–30s, including Japan, excess nasolabial fat—above the folds—is often a key factor.
This study evaluates nasolabial fat liposuction with a thread lift, a procedure that removes fat and prevents sagging for facial rejuvenation.
We assessed cases treated at our clinic using 3D imaging analysis and patient surveys to determine the efficacy of this combined approach.
Introduction: Nasolabial folds result from age-related factors such as skin laxity, fat redistribution, and skeletal changes, making them a prevalent aesthetic concern.
Various treatment modalities, including dermal fillers, liposuction, and thread lifts, have been explored, each with inherent limitations.
This study investigates the synergistic benefits of combining nasolabial fat liposuction with a thread lift to achieve optimal facial rejuvenation outcomes.
Materials / method: This study included 21 patients, aged 20 to 50, who underwent combined nasolabial fat liposuction and thread lift.
The procedure was performed under intravenous anesthesia using microcannula liposuction, followed by the insertion of polydioxanone (PDO) threads along the
nasolabial folds and midface region.
Treatment outcomes were assessed through visual analysis
(before-and-after photo comparisons), volumetric changes in the nasolabial fat area (measured via specialized equipment), and patient satisfaction surveys, including FACE-Q assessments andx.
Results: The combined treatment significantly reduced the depth and visibility of nasolabial folds.
At the three-month follow-up, objective 3D imaging (Life Viz®️) demonstrated an average reduction of 0.50cc in nasolabial fat volume.
The FACE-Q assessment for "nasolabial fold depth (bare face)"
yielded an average score of 3.29, reflecting high patient satisfaction.
Postoperative symptoms such as pain, swelling, warmth, and tightness were noted but resolved completely within three months, with no severe complications reported.
Conclusion: This study highlights the efficacy of nasolabial fat liposuction with a thread lift in reducing nasolabial folds and enhancing facial rejuvenation.
Objective 3D imaging confirmed fat volume reduction, while high patient satisfaction reinforced its effectiveness.
Mild postoperative symptoms resolved within three months, with no severe complications.
These findings suggest this combined approach is a safe, effective option for individuals in their 20s to 50s seeking facial contour refinement.
